Rolex mechanical watch
Mechanical watches with a service network that keeps them running for generations.
What owners say
- Some owners say the case and crystal shrug off decades of hard wear with mostly cosmetic marks.
- Owners note it needs periodic servicing to keep running; one who left his about 15 years found the movement gummed up and needing a costly deep clean.
- A few note timekeeping is only modest for the price, gaining or losing a few seconds a day.
